app开发 真没想到app开发工具有哪些
产品目录:
1.app合作开发源代码
2.app合作开发几万元
3.app合作开发难吗
4.app合作开发民营企业在优先选择上通常优先优先选择开
5.app合作软件设计
6.app合作开发公司
7.app合作开发网络平台
8.app合作应用软件有甚么样
9.app合作开发自修讲义
10.app合作开发公司另一家好
1.app合作开发源代码
译者 | Tim Sommer 翻译者 | 薛命灯 那些知名的软件合作开发运动定律,你都晓得甚么样? 与其它应用领域那样,软件合作开发应用领域也有许多十分有意思的运动定律开发人员、控制技术副经理和CTO们时常在全会和闲聊中提及它。
2.app合作开发几万元
做为阿宝,他们时常多于点点头非难的份,即使他们不期望让旁人晓得他们事实上显然不晓得罗德斯、安德森或是杰斯都是甚么人这些运动定律主要包括了许多自然法则或软件合作开发天神的名句它都很有意思,值得称赞他们一探到底,所以每一运动定律另一面都有绝妙的大背景故事情节。
3.app合作开发难吗
在这篇文章中,我将分享我对软件合作开发应用领域最知名和最常见的运动定律的解释和想法 墨菲运动定律(Murphys Law) 可能是最知名的运动定律之一,主要是即使它不仅适用于软件合作开发如果事情可能出错,它就会出错第一个推论:那些有效的(代码),你可能反而没有写出来。
4.app合作开发民营企业在优先选择上通常优先优先选择开
第二个推论:诅咒是唯一一门所有开发人员都能流利说出来的语言结论:电脑会按照你所写的(代码)去做,而不是按照你所想的去做防御性编程、版本控制、末日场景(针对那些该死的僵尸服务器攻击)、TDD、MDD,等等,那些都是针对这一运动定律的防御性实践。
5.app合作软件设计
罗德斯运动定律(Brooks Law) 大多数合作开发人员都有意无意地经历过罗德斯运动定律,该运动定律指出:为已经延期的软件项目增加人手只会让项目延期得更厉害如果一个项目出现了延期,只是简单地增加人手很可能会带来灾难性的后果。
6.app合作开发公司
对编程效率、软件合作开发方法、控制技术架构等因素进行评审总是会带来更好的结果如果没有,那说明霍夫施塔特运动定律也在起作用 霍夫施塔特运动定律(Hofstadters Law) 霍夫施塔特运动定律由 Douglas Hofstadter 提出,并以他的名字命名。
7.app合作开发网络平台
当然,不要将这个定律与电视剧《大爆炸》里的 Leonard Hofstadter 混淆起来了,尽管他说的许多话对某些人来说是有一点意义的。
8.app合作应用软件有甚么样
这个运动定律指出:即使你考虑到了霍夫施塔特运动定律,项目的实际完成时间总是比预期的要长这个“运动定律”是关于准确预估完成复杂任务所需时间的难度这个运动定律具有递归性,反映了预估复杂项目的难度,尽管你可能已经做出了最大的努力,所以也晓得任务的复杂性。
9.app合作开发自修讲义
这就是为甚么在进行项目预估时必须要有一个缓冲区 康威运动定律(Conway’s Law) 软件的结构反映了合作软件设计的组织的结构或是说得更清楚一点:组织所设计的系统的结构受限于组织的通信结构很多组织是根据功能性技能来划分团队的,所以会有前端合作开发团队、后端合作开发团队和数据库合作开发团队。
10.app合作开发公司另一家好
简单地说,如果某人想要改变的东西属于其它人,那么他就很难改变那些东西现在越来越多的组织根据有界上下文来组建团队,而微服务等架构也在根据服务边界而不是孤立的控制技术架构分区来组建团队因此,根据目标软件架构来组建团队可以更容易实现软件架构,而这就是对抗康威法律的一种有效方式。
波斯托运动定律(Postels Law)或鲁棒性自然法则 保守输出,自由输入Jon Postel 最初将它做为实现健壮的 TCP 的一个原则这个原则也体现在 HTML 中,HTML 的成败可以归因于它的很多属性,但到底 HTML 是成功的还是失败的,不同的人有不同的看法。
帕累托自然法则(Pareto Principle)或 80/20 自然法则 对于很多现象,80%的后果源于 20%的原因80%的 bug 来自 20%的代码,这个说的就是帕累托自然法则还有人说,公司里 80%的工作是由 20%的员工完成的,问题是你并不清楚是哪 20%员工。
彼得自然法则(The Peter Principle) 这是一个相当令人沮丧的运动定律,特别是如果你碰巧亲身经历过在一个等级制度中,每一员工都倾向于晋升到他无法胜任的职位呆伯特(Dilbert)系列漫画中有许多这方面的例子。
基尔霍夫自然法则(Kerchkhoffs Principle) 在密码学中,系统应该是安全的,即使系统的所有东西都是公开的——除了一小部分信息——秘钥这是公钥密码学的主要自然法则 莱纳斯运动定律(Linuss Law) 。
这是以 Linux 之父 Linus Torvalds 的名字命名的,该运动定律指出:如果有足够多的眼睛,所有的 bug 都将无所遁形可以使用知名的《大教堂与集市》来描述这个运动定律,它解释了两种不同的自由软件合作开发模型之间的对比:。
大教堂模型——每一软件发行版都提供源代码,但发行版之间的代码合作开发仅限于一组专有的软件合作开发人员集市模型——代码合作开发通过互联网公开进行结论?对源代码进行更广泛的公开测试、评审和实验,就会更快地发现各种形式的 bug。
安德森运动定律(Moores Law) 单位成本的计算机算力每 24 个月翻一番。最流行的版本是说:集成电路上的晶体管数量大约每 18 个月会增加一倍。或是:计算机的处理速度每两年翻一番!
沃斯运动定律(Wirths Law) 软件比硬件更容易变慢参考一下安德森运动定律吧! 九九自然法则(Ninety-Ninety Rule) 前 90%的代码占用了 10%的时间,其余的 10%代码占用了剩下的 90%时间。
有人不同意这个的吗? 克努特优化自然法则(Knuths Optimization Principle) 过早优化是万恶之源。
先写代码,然后找出瓶颈,最后才修复! 诺维格运动定律(Norvigs Law) 任何超过 50%渗透率的控制技术都不会再次翻倍(无论在多少个月内) 真香运动定律 别更新了,我学不动了!……真香所有开发人员都逃不过的运动定律,同意吗?。
以上软件合作开发运动定律,你都知道几条?你还晓得有甚么样软件合作开发的黄金运动定律吗?欢迎留言告诉他们!今日荐文点击下方图片即可阅读
中国互联网公司开源项目调查报告
点个在看少个 bug